(33) Energy released when organic compounds break down is measured in what unit?

Biology
1 answer:
Svetlanka [38]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

Calories

Explanation:

It is called calories because calories is the unit of measuring energy gotten from the consumption of food or drink when it is breakdown.

During digestion, when the bonds binding food are broken down, energy is released . This energy is used for metabolic activities of the body and the energy released is measured in units called kilocalories or calories
